Spotted Batfish [Halieutaea lunulata]

Description

Spotted Batfish, or Halieutaea lunulata, is a species of anglerfish widely distributed in the Indo-Pacific region. They are typically found in deep, sandy or muddy substrates. The Spotted Batfish has a flattened body and a large, broad head. Its body is covered with small white spots on a dark background, and it has a distinctive, crescent-shaped marking on its tail, thus the name 'lunulata'.
